Can Bolton Shake the Blackburn Jinx?

Bolton take on Blackburn Rovers at the weekend, without a home win against the mob from up the road since September 2000, when both teams occupied the division below.

Of course there have been victories, and memorable ones, but not at the Reebok. Youri Djorkaeff starred as the Whites came from 3-1 behind to win at Ewood Park in 2004, El Hadji Diouf was the hero/villain (depending on your allegiance) a year later and an Ivan Campo header was the difference in 2006.

Penalties have figured greatly in the last few encounters. The Whites have conceded seven of them in five games against Blackburn. Mike Dean, the referee on Sunday gave two, both missed, in the third match mentioned above.

Breaking the jinx is close to essential for Gary Megson`s men. After showing some improvement on a poor start to the season, they`ve conceded thirteen goals in the last three games with defensive frailties that have been apparent for some time being punished.

It won`t, as Mark Lawrenson will undoubtedly say, be one for the purists. Both teams lack quality, neither can defend. A win for the home side would confirm what has been referred to elsewhere as the 'Megson Cycle` - the Ginger One presides over a string of dismal performances, but picks up a few points now and then, just enough to hold onto his job.

The Whites could already be in the bottom three before the game is played. A loss and they`ll stay there and with a difficult game against Fulham the week after, the tenure may not be short.
